What happens to stained napkins from a New Barnet service?

Kitchen soil is treated as kitchen soil. Grease, red wine, oil and candle wax each need a different combination of temperature, dwell time and chemistry, and no single programme gets all four out.

  • Items are sorted before washing, not after. Sorting after the wash is too late; the grease has already moved.
  • Marked items are pulled at the check stage and re-treated before they go back out. Most recover; the ones that do not are replaced from stock rather than returned to you to notice.
  • Wax is lifted before wash, cold and mechanically — a hot cycle is what makes candle wax permanent.
Is kitchenwear on the same EN5 round?

Yes — and on the same visit. Splitting linen and workwear across two suppliers is how one of them ends up late.

  • Whites come back on hangers, sized and named where you want them named, so they go straight to the changing area rather than onto a pile.
  • Cloths are bagged by type — glass, oven, waiter — because sorting a mixed bag at 5pm is nobody's job.
  • Sizes are held in stock, and a change of size is a phone call rather than a reorder.

The cheapest wash for New Barnet is the second one you avoid

Most of the environmental cost of restaurant linen is rewashing and early replacement, not the wash itself — a cloth retired at the first oil mark has cost more than one washed twice. In New Barnet there is a second saving: the kitchens here sit close enough together that one round covers them, instead of separate journeys out from Wembley.

  • One EN5 round serves New Barnet, East Barnet and Cockfosters — 3 areas, one set of miles.
  • A 7.7-mile plant distance is the transport cost of every collection here — it is why routing matters more than detergent.
  • Water from the final rinse is recovered and feeds the next wash rather than the drain.
  • Oil and wine marks are re-treated before an item is retired. Most recover.
